-JohnThe only time I've heard about this error was when someone was using custom tissue probability maps (which I assume had problems because it contained some zero or negative probabilities, which screws up computing log probabilities ). If this is not the case for you, then I have no idea what the cause of the problem is. I'd suggest trying a Check Reg against some of the images released with SPM. This can sometimes give clues (eg from totally inappropriate voxel sizes, image orientation etc).Best regards,
